Spring can seem to take forever to really arrive on the North Fork. But when even the large trees begin to turn green you know it’s finally here. This photo, taken in May a few years ago from Pennys Road looking up towards Northville Beach, captures the early season’s cover crop in one field, another field ready for planting, and the new light green growth on the trees.
